Mass and diameter of a ring is 2 kg and 1 m respectively. The moment of inertia of ring about an axis is passing through its C.M. and perpendicular to the plane of the ring is
Options
(a) 0.5 kg m²
(b) 1 kg m²
(c) 1.5 kg m²
(d) 2 kg m²
Correct Answer:
0.5 kg m²
